Position of robot
Use this procedure to place the robot in the position recommended in order to
facilitate replacement of motors.

CAUTION
Action
Axis-1, axis-4, axis-5 and axis-6 motor (IRB
2600 Standard)
Axis-1 and axis-4 motors (IRB 2600ID)
Move the robot to a position where the
wrist is pointing to the floor, as shown in
the figure. This will make it possible to
remove the motors without draining the
oil from the gearbox.
Axis-2 motor
Move the robot to a position where the
lower arm rests firmly on the damper of
axes 2 and 3. Release the brake of axis
2 to be sure that the lower arm rests in
the end position.
Axis-3 motor
Move axis-2 to 0° and axis-3 to maximal
+. Release the brake of axis-3 to be sure
that the upper arm is completely vertical
and rests against the damper of axis-2
and axis-3.
